About the role
Reckitt is seeking a dynamic Talent Acquisition Advisor to join our Europe Hub team.
In this role, you will be the crucial link between exceptional talent and impactful career opportunities across our key markets European Markets.
This is an exciting opportunity to join a dynamic regional TA team where you’ll help shape how we attract, engage, and hire exceptional talent.
As a cultural and linguistic expert for your market, you’ll help shape the future of our talent pipeline, drive innovation in sourcing, and connect people to meaningful work. If you're passionate about talent acquisition and want your impact to be felt across a multinational organisation, let’s shape tomorrow together.
Your responsibilities
- Manage end‑to‑end recruitment across assigned functions, ensuring a smooth and inclusive process for all candidates.
- Develop and execute market‑specific sourcing strategies
- Build strong and lasting candidate relationships, ensuring world‑class communication and engagement.
- Partner closely with hiring managers to understand talent needs and provide insights on market conditions.
- Leverage recruitment platforms to keep processes efficient, compliant, and data‑driven.
- Track recruitment metrics, using data to guide decisions, improve diversity outcomes, and inform stakeholders.
- Support employer branding efforts to strengthen Reckitt’s visibility across your market.
- Balance multiple priorities effectively while maintaining a high standard of delivery.
The experience we're looking for
- Fluency in Italian and strong English proficiency.
- Proven expertise in end-to-end Talent Acquisition, sourcing and assessing high‑quality talent.
- Experience managing candidate relationships with care, transparency, and professionalism.
- Strong communication skills and ability to collaborate with diverse stakeholders.
- Strong organisational and project management abilities; comfortable juggling multiple processes at once.
